The health department has logged 12 inspections at Pour Decisions, the earliest from 2012. The latest inspection on file is from Jun 3, 2025. Low risk means the most recent visit produced few or no significant findings.

Recent inspections have turned up roughly the same number of issues each time, hovering near five violations per visit.

“Walls, ceilings, attached equipment constructed per code” accounts for the largest share of issues, appearing 10 times across the record.

That puts the facility ahead of the local pack: the average Chicago restaurant scores 81. The record reflects steady performance over time.
